Lewington Court is situated close to shops and railway station and consists of 40 flats completed in 2001.

Facilities include a resident manager and emergency alarm service, lift, communal lounge, laundry, guest facilities and garden.

Enfield was mentioned in Domesday as having a mill, fishponds and park and in the 16th century was much smaller than its neighbour Enfield Chase. Today it is a cosmopolitan township and borough of Greater London with open country areas and several wooded parks. Keats lived nearby as did Leigh Hunt in Southgate. Sir Nicholas Raynton had Forty Hall built in the 17th century set in its own Park with cedars and a lake. It is now a museum. Nearby is the Parish church of St Andrew with its many interesting monuments and brasses and an organ case dated 1572.
